One Real Rely LLC is already clearing land at the site and hopes to get approval from Dublin City Council to move forward ...
Four tech businesses have officially become a part of the Jefferson Center, occupying 60% of the newly dubbed 'Innovation Post'. "There's a larger vision here today that begins to take shape," said ...